I think there's something that people need to understand & acknowledge.

For every action There is an equal in opposite reaction.

So on one hand a team says They are taking away the middle, That suggests that there is space to the outside. A team might say they are taking away all of the short And intermediate stuff. That suggests the deep stuff is open. A team might say they are Hi Hyper focused on shutting down the running game which means the passing game is going to find some success. Or they might B hyperfocused on shutting down the passing game which means the running game is going to have some success.

This is true in any football game at any level. It is absolutely impossible to shut everything down and take everything away. You might write that you are doing so in your game plan but if people are actually being realistic and logical they are smart enough to know that that is impossible. I'm not Specifically talking about This game but it is very True in this game but I am talking about everybody's game
